About Sung‐Ha Lee
Sung‐Ha Lee is a scholar working on Molecular Biology, Social Psychology, Health, General Health Professions and Biological Psychiatry, having authored 27 papers that have together received 367 indexed citations. Recurring topics across this work include Psychological Well-being and Life Satisfaction (4 papers), Gut microbiota and health (3 papers), Health disparities and outcomes (3 papers), Tryptophan and brain disorders (3 papers), Optimism, Hope, and Well-being (2 papers), Health, psychology, and well-being (2 papers), Neurotransmitter Receptor Influence on Behavior (2 papers) and Stress Responses and Cortisol (2 papers). The work is most often cited by research in General Decision Sciences (28 citations), Biological Psychiatry (13 citations), Applied Psychology (22 citations), Behavioral Neuroscience (14 citations) and Experimental and Cognitive Psychology (47 citations). Sung‐Ha Lee has collaborated with scholars based in South Korea, United States and Puerto Rico. Frequent co-authors include Woo‐Young Ahn, Incheol Choi, Antoine Bechara, Jasmin Vassileva, Jerome R. Busemeyer, John K. Kruschke, Bumjo Oh, Wolfgang Sadée, Yeonjae Jung and Ui-Gi Min. Their work appears in journals such as Psychoneuroendocrinology, Health Psychology, Applied Psychology Health and Well-Being, PLoS ONE and Psychology of Aesthetics Creativity and the Arts.
